Four Bisons Earn ASUN Postseason Honors

ATLANTA - As the regular season draws to a close and the anticipation for postseason play builds, the league has unveiled their All-ASUN Team selections for the 2024 season. Four Bisons, Trace Willhoite, Alex Vergara, Mason Lundgrin, and Collin Witzke, have been selected to an All-ASUN Team. Willhoite and Vergara have been selected to the Second Team, while Lundgrin and Witzke have made the Third Team list. Willhoite, Lundgrin, and Witzke also earned Academic All-ASUN Team honors.

Versatile infielder Trace Willhoite was voted Preseason ASUN Defensive Player of the Year in February after a stellar year at third base during the Bisons Championships season. This year, Willhoite transitioned to a full-time shortstop and didn't skip a beat, earning Second-Team All-ASUN for the second straight season. The Georgetown, Kentucky, native played in all 53 games for the Bisons in his third year with the program. Overall, Wilhoite slashed .311/.689/.425 with 61 hits, 59 RBI, 19 home runs, 13 doubles, and two triples on the season. His hits, RBI, and slugging percentage led the Bisons' power-hitting offense. In ASUN action, Willhoite was even better, slashing .349/.789/.461 with 13 home runs, 44 RBI, seven doubles, and 20 walks. The graduate shortstop logged 16 multi-hit and 15 multi-RBI games, including four games with four RBI. Willhoite became Lipscomb's all-time career RBI leader earlier in the season, adding to his long list of career accolades. 

Alex Vergara earned preseason honor in February as well and certainly lived up to the hype during the regular season. After another excellent season for the Bisons, Vergara also earned Second Team All-ASUN honors. The Colleyville, Texas, native slashed .288/.644/.406 on the year with 60 hits, 20 home runs, 46 RBI, 14 doubles, and 61 runs scored as the lead-off man for the Bisons. He led the team and finished third in the conference in home runs this season. In the 30 conference games, Vergara slashed .302/.651/.397 with 38 hits, 28 RBI, 11 home runs, 11 doubles, and 18 walks. He logged 17 multi-hit, which led the team, and 14 multi-RBI games for the Bisons this season.

For the first time in his three-year stint with Lipscomb, Collin Witzke earned postseason honors and was selected Third-Team All-ASUN. Witzke was the Bisons' go-to closer the entire season, finishing the regular season with a 3.34 ERA in 21 appearances, 19 of which were in relief. He earned four saves in his 29.2 innings of work while allowing only 11 earned runs, with 32 strikeouts. In conference play, Witzke was dominant, ending the 30-game slate with a .73 ERA on ten appearances. In those outings, he allowed only seven hits and one earned run with 14 punch outs, and only five walks. Conference opponents were only able to hit .167 against him. 

Lipscomb Ken Dugan Award winner and three-year starting first baseman Mason Lundgrin rounded out the Bisons' postseason team selections. Lundgrin also earned his first All-ASUN selection, with a spot on the Third Team list. The Salina, Kansas, native had a career year slashing .319/.503/475 this season with 59 hits, 34 RBI, eight home runs, and ten doubles. His batting average and 39 walks led the Bisons this season. In ASUN games, Lundgrin slashed .330/.491/.465 in ASUN with 37 hits, 23 RBI, four home runs, six doubles, and 20 walks. He logged 16 multi-hit and eight multi-RBI games  while also being outstanding defensively at first, collecting a .989 fielding percentage with 414 putouts and 24 assists on the year.
